An Overview of Metal Polishing - Most frequently, metal finishing is important for aesthetics or for clean-room uses. It really is among the most popular processes due to its utility in intensifying the original beauty of the item, for instance, motorcycle parts, automobile parts or kitchenware. Additionally, plenty of clean-rooms will require a sleek finish so to minimize the permeability of the material that will cause particles to collect and contaminate. A really good example of this usage might be in a vacuum chamber.

There are a great number of different ways to finish metal, and we will look at some of the techniques required. Various metals may be finished by hand, using special buffing machines, electromechanically or chemically. A finishing paste or compound can be utilised, that could contain dolomite, limestone, tripoli, aluminum oxide, chromium oxide, chalk, or iron oxide.

Buffing stainless steel, due to its inferior th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its quite high viscosity is in general one of the most time-consuming. More over, things composed of non-ferrous metals are much more responsive to finishing, as these demand the lowest amount of operations.

Finishing buffs plastered in compound will be profoundly affected by the forces on the buffing pad. The level of the surface pressure could be accelerated to a specified range, although surpassing the most effective degree of force not simply decreases the quality of the procedure, but additionally degrades performance, could potentially cause wear on the part, and there's also a significant heating up of the objects being worked on, brought about by friction. When working thin objects, it is elevated heat (and the corresponding flexibility of the material) that will quite possibly cause parts to distort, warp or bend. In general, it requires an educated polisher to factor in all of these points to equally prevent harm to the workpiece and to work proficiently. To substantially boost the standard of the finished finish, the polishing operation must be carried out with reduced aggression and not a large amount of force in order to ultimately produce a surface that doesn't have any scratches or marks coming from the finishing procedure, thereby arriving at a brilliant mirror finish.
